About Insurance in Walker County
Homeowner insurance in Walker County, Alabama costs an estimated $683 per year for a median-value home of $124,100. This represents approximately 1.3% of the median household income of $52,987.
Actual premiums depend on your home's age, construction type, claims history, credit score, proximity to fire stations, and specific peril exposures. Use our calculator for a personalized total cost of risk analysis with peril-by-peril breakdown.
